Andy Emulator Root Free And PaidBlueStacks A superb emulator that brings Android games to your desktop Good quality Reliable Free and paid-for versions Games platform only BlueStacks App Player is perhaps the best-known Android emulator, and its hardly surprising given its quality and reliability. BlueStacks has been designed with ease of use in mind, and looks and feels just like Android on a tablet or smartphone. The free one includes some ads and the occasional sponsored app, but these are pretty discreet. BlueStacks is primarily about games and the interface is essentially a front end for downloading and installing them, but its also possible to visit the Google Play Store and search for other apps. If you want to add apps and games from other sources, you have the option of using standalone APK files. Performance is decent assuming your hardware is reasonably powerful, making this a great way to bring Android to the big screen. Nox A free emulator that lets you sideload apps from outside Google Play Gamepad compatibility Not just for games Recording options Like BlueStacks App Player, Nox is a fast, slick Android emulator for PC and Mac. If youre planning to use Nox for gaming, youll be pleased to learn that you can use your favorite gamepad, and you have the option of mapping keys or buttons to perform various Android gestures. Nox gives you a stock version of Android, and while its designed with gamers in mind, you can install other apps from the Google Play Store too.
